⬇️ A.J. Brown Under 61.5 receiving yards (-115) ⭐⭐⭐⭐

NFL Player Prop Bets Today: Week 3 Odds & Expert Picks
 Omarr Norman-Lott tackles Philadelphia Eagles wide receiver A.J. Brown. Photo by Jay Biggerstaff-Imagn Images

Is A.J. Brown ... OK?

Brown has a total of 35 yards on six catches through two games this year, and is now going up against a Los Angeles Rams defense that is the fourth-best unit against the pass early in the season. Brown's combined 35 yards in two games is the lowest regular-season two-game total of his career since Week 2 and 3 of his rookie season in 2019 - when he totaled 29 yards.

Granted, Los Angeles shut down the Tennessee Titans a week ago, but in Week 1, they locked Nico Collins down to three catches for 25 yards. This will be the first real test, but so far, if any team has had any success against the Rams, it's been on the ground, which means a steady dose of Saquon Barkley is likely on the way.

We might be seeing some Brown tantrums on the sideline come Week 3.

Stick to BetMGM for this wager, as other sportsbooks have his total at or near the 59.5 area. The -115 odds will pay you $8.70 on a $10 winning wager.

🔥 Ashton Jeanty Under 71.5 rushing and receiving yards (-115) ⭐⭐⭐⭐

Brian Fluharty-Imagn Images
Ashton Jeanty rushes the ball. Photo by Brian Fluharty-Imagn Images

Another week, another Ashton Jeanty Under. We’ll be fading the Jeanty train until the wheels fall off as part of our rookie player prop bets for Week 3 – or until the rookie catches up to the speed of NFL action. While Jeanty has plenty of talent, the Raiders’ offensive line doesn’t. The unit ranks 32nd in run-block win rate (62%) and now must deal with the Commanders’ second-ranked unit in run-stop win rate (37%).

The books were content to leave Jeanty’s rushing yardage prop in the high-60s-to-low-70s over the first two weeks, but it looks like his Week 3 line is opening in the 50s. That’s OK. We can simply play him for Under 71.5 rushing and receiving yards. Jeanty’s awful pass blocking makes him a liability on passing downs, so he likely won’t get many chances as a dump-off receiver.

Lock this wager in for the cheap price of -115 (53.5%) at BetMGM to score an $8.70 profit on a $10 bet.

How do NFL player props work?

Player props are wagers on individual performances rather than the outcome of the game. Common props include passing yards, rushing yards, receiving yards, and touchdown scorers. For example, if a QB’s passing yards line is set at 250.5, you can bet the Over (251-plus yards) or Under (250 or fewer yards). You can also bet on if a specific player will score a touchdown in the entire game, the first or last touchdown, and more NFL odds.
